    Tragic story. I'm familiar with the area, as I've been surfing/camping in Baja for decades. For the past 10 years, that spot has been known by traveling surfers to be the most dangerous surf spot on the entire coast of Baja. There have been numerous incidents of robbing at gunpoint and carjacking at gunpoint. This isn't cartel related. Instead, it's a few local Mexicans who are meth-heads that are desperate for money, or things of value that they can sell. Unfortunately, northern Baja has a growing meth problem.
